The Internet of Things refers to a network of interconnected devices that can communicate and exchange data with each other. In the automotive industry, IoT technology plays a crucial role in transforming traditional vehicles into smart, connected cars. By equipping vehicles with sensors, actuators, and communication modules, IoT enables cars to collect and transmit data in real-time, enhancing safety, efficiency, and convenience for drivers and passengers. Here are some potential career paths in the automotive sector with a focus on IoT technology: 1. Connected Car Engineer: Connected car engineers specialize in designing and developing the software and hardware components that enable vehicles to connect to the internet and communicate with other devices. They work on integrating IoT technology into vehicles to enable features such as remote diagnostics, real-time navigation, and vehicle-to-vehicle communication. 2. Automotive Data Analyst: Automotive data analysts are responsible for collecting and analyzing data generated by connected vehicles to derive insights that improve performance, safety, and user experience. They work with large datasets to identify trends, patterns, and anomalies that can inform decision-making and optimize vehicle functionalities. 3. IoT Solution Architect: IoT solution architects design and implement systems that enable seamless connectivity and communication between vehicles, infrastructure, and digital platforms. They develop architectural frameworks that support the integration of IoT technology in the automotive ecosystem, ensuring interoperability, scalability, and security. 4. Telematics Specialist: Telematics specialists focus on deploying telematics systems in vehicles to enable communication, tracking, and remote monitoring capabilities. They configure telematics devices, install software applications, and troubleshoot connectivity issues to ensure seamless operation of IoT-enabled features in cars. 5. Embedded Systems Engineer: Embedded systems engineers design and program the embedded systems that control IoT devices and sensors in vehicles. They work on developing firmware, drivers, and applications that enable efficient operation and communication of embedded systems within the automotive environment.
